Los Angeles, CA –We are pleased to
announceMaya Hamouie and Kasia
Pennhave been elevated to partnership in the Firm.

“Maya and Kasia are outstanding additions to Nossaman’s
partnership,” said David Graeler, Nossaman’s managing
partner. “Their elevation reflects their unwavering commitment
to our core values of delivering best-in-class client service,
fostering collaboration and achieving positive outcomes for the
clients and communities we serve. I look forward to their continued
success at Nossaman.”

Maya focuses on construction claims, contract administration and
bid protests for public agencies and private owners on major public
works projects across the United States. Her practice centers on
high-stakes infrastructure matters involving delay and disruption
claims, changes and extra work claims, liquidated damages, schedule
and cost impacts, differing site conditions, force majeure and
excusable delay events, contract interpretation and procurement
challenges. Maya represents clients in all phases of construction
and procurement disputes, from pre-claim counseling and contract
administration through dispute review board proceedings, mediation,
arbitration and trial. She holds a J.D. from the University of
Houston Law Center and a B.B.A. from the University of Texas at
Austin. She is based in Nossaman’s Los Angeles and Austin
offices.

Kasia is a litigation attorney whose practice focuses on complex
litigation, business actions and commercial disputes. She has
extensive experience handling matters involving general liability
and product liability. She also practices insurance recovery and
has significant experience working on multiparty cases. She
represents businesses and individuals as both plaintiffs and
defendants in all stages of litigation, from early case assessment
and strategic negotiation to trial. She holds a J.D. from the
University of California, Los Angeles School of Law and an M.A. and
B.A. from the University of San Francisco. She works out of the
Orange County office.
